The first step is to determine which type of key you're using. There are two typesof keys: A Chrome SmartKey(r) and an older SmartKey(r).

Lexus.jpgTo determine which type of key you have, look at the panic button on your fob. A newer Chrome SmartKey(r) has a panic button that's triangular in form, while an older SmartKey(r) has a panic key that's circular.

If you're not certain which key you're using, it's a good idea to take your car to a mechanic who will examine the panic button for you. They'll tell you whether your key is older or newer and may even be able to change the battery.

Broken Ignition

If you have a newer Mercedes Benz, you may find that the key for your car won't turn the ignition. This could be because the key is damaged or lost. This problem is easily resolved by obtaining a new Mercedesbenz key from the local locksmith.

The majority of these keys are equipped with a microchip that communicates the engine control unit (ECU) to allow you to start your vehicle. These keys are commonly called smart keys. These keys are much more user-friendly than traditional keys fobs.

When a key goes into the ignition the ignition switch is activated an array of switches that provide power to various components of your car's electrical system. The circuits that power the radio, lights as well as other features of your vehicle are controlled by these switches.

A damaged or broken switch can cause a key to not turn on your ignition. A malfunctioning switch will stop the key from turning on and may cause your vehicle to stall.
